|
|
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
У меня есть основная таблица и несколько второстепенных. Одной записи из основной таблицы может соответствовать несколько записей из второстепенной. Мне нужно вывести их как единую таблицу, если я просто делаю через left join, то у меня выводится куча избыточной, дублирующей информации, которая мне не нужна. Например: Код: plsql 1. 2. 3. 4. 5. 6. 7. То выведется что-то типа изображенного на картинке 1. Как видно, add и app таблицы не связаны между собой, они связаны только с основной таблицей main. Можно ли как-то построить запрос, чтобы не было дублирующей информации и вывод был соответственно, как на картинке 2.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:00 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
Не получилось изменить приложенный файл, поэтому вот он 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:04 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
на первом рисунке нет дублирующейся информации 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:14 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
Это будет что-то типа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:27 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
ScareCrow на первом рисунке нет дублирующейся информации 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:29 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
Akina Это будет что-то типа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:30 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
volnistii11 а можно объяснить, если не сложно? Давайте Вы сначала выполните, изучите и попробуете понять, что делает Код: sql 1. потом Код: sql 1. ... и так далее. И вот когда не поймёте очередной вывод - тогда и спросите конкретно по моменту.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:34 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
volnistii11 можно как-то это сделать без WITH, а то версия моего mysql<8.0, а именно 5.5 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 14:35 |
|
||
|
SQL избыточные данные при left join
|
|||
|---|---|---|---|
|
#18+
Akina volnistii11 можно как-то это сделать без WITH, а то версия моего mysql<8.0, а именно 5.5 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 01.10.2020, 15:05 |
|
||
|
|

start [/forum/topic.php?fid=47&msg=40004556&tid=1828367]: |
0ms |
get settings: |
9ms |
get forum list: |
13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
155ms |
get topic data: |
13ms |
get forum data: |
3ms |
get page messages: |
47ms |
get tp. blocked users: |
2ms |
| others: | 13ms |
| total: | 263ms |

| 0 / 0 |

Извините, эт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
... ля, ля, ля ...